2 x 150 W class-D power amplifier The TDA8950J is a high-efficiency Class-D audio amplifier manufactured by NXP Semiconductors. Below are its specifications, descriptions, and features based on factual information from Ic-phoenix technical data files:

### **Specifications:**
- **Output Power:**  
  - 2 × 150 W (4 Ω, THD = 10%)  
  - 2 × 210 W (2 Ω, THD = 10%)  
  - 1 × 420 W (4 Ω, BTL mode, THD = 10%)  
- **Supply Voltage Range:** ±12.5 V to ±40 V  
- **Efficiency:** Up to 90%  
- **THD (Total Harmonic Distortion):** <0.1% (typical)  
- **Signal-to-Noise Ratio (SNR):** >100 dB  
- **Operating Temperature Range:** -40°C to +85°C  
- **Package:** HSOP24 (Heat Sink Small Outline Package)  

### **Descriptions:**  
- The TDA8950J is a stereo or mono Class-D amplifier designed for high-power audio applications.  
- It uses a switching amplifier topology for high efficiency, reducing heat dissipation.  
- Suitable for professional audio systems, home theaters, and active speaker designs.  
- Includes protection features such as over-temperature, over-voltage, and short-circuit protection.  

### **Features:**  
- **High Efficiency:** Minimizes power loss and heat generation.  
- **Flexible Configuration:** Can operate in stereo (2-channel) or mono (BTL bridge-tied load) mode.  
- **Mute and Standby Functions:** Allows power-saving modes.  
- **Integrated Protection Circuits:** Includes thermal shutdown, over-voltage, and short-circuit protection.  
- **Low External Component Count:** Simplifies PCB design.
